Output 577f36553a5a483567b20e49dea8e8dc4b010a1aff5ea2ea03fdb3ebec6941b1:0

value
169360
script pubkey
OP_0 OP_PUSHBYTES_20 2500d937494fad69c30d3aa595283a84dcf4b53f
address
bc1qy5qdjd6ff7kknscd82je22p6snw0fdflxn8n2p
transaction
577f36553a5a483567b20e49dea8e8dc4b010a1aff5ea2ea03fdb3ebec6941b1
confirmations
58867
spent
true